2 Solar Eclipses Are Coming, Including the ‘Eclipse of the Century’: Everything to Know

The first whole photo voltaic eclipse arrives on August 12, 2026. The Moon’s shadow will begin over northern Siberia, sweep throughout jap Greenland, skim Iceland’s west coast, then cross northern Spain earlier than setting over the Mediterranean.

For mainland Europe, that is thrilling. It’s the primary whole photo voltaic eclipse seen there since 1999. In Spain, cities like León, Burgos, and Valladolid sit straight within the path of totality. Observers there’ll see the Sun drop to totality simply earlier than sundown, about 10 levels above the horizon. That’s roughly the width of a clenched fist held at arm’s size.

Totality in Spain will final below two minutes, which sounds transient till you’re residing it. Clear skies are probably, and the timing overlaps with the annual Perseid meteor bathe. Live Science notes there’s even an opportunity of recognizing a meteor in the course of the eerie twilight of totality.

If period issues greater than comfort, Iceland’s Snæfellsnes Peninsula or jap Greenland supply simply over two minutes of totality. At these latitudes, August nights barely exist, however auroras sometimes make appearances in the course of the brief darkness and even throughout totality itself.

August 2, 2027: The Eclipse of the Century

The second eclipse, on August 2, 2027, is the one astronomers hold circling. Totality will last as long as 6 minutes and 22 seconds, an virtually absurd period of time for the Sun to vanish. The path crosses elements of Spain, then sweeps by means of North Africa and the Middle East, together with Morocco, Algeria, Tunisia, Libya, Egypt, Saudi Arabia, Yemen, and Somalia.

Observers close to Luxor, Egypt, will expertise the longest land-based totality of the twenty first century. The area’s local weather additionally stacks the percentages in your favor. Clear skies are frequent in August, so the drastic darkness goes to really feel extremely creepy.

One More, Just Beyond

There’s a 3rd whole photo voltaic eclipse on July 22, 2028, crossing Australia and New Zealand. Sydney will see its first totality since 1857. For eclipse chasers, the following few years qualify as a golden window.
